使用GEWE框架进行个人微信收藏夹及标签管理(标签篇)适用于微信群管、社群管理

友情链接 geweapi.com  点击即可访问!

添加标签

简要描述:
  • 添加自定义标签 注意[name]
请求URL:
  • http://域名地址/api/label/add
请求方式:
  • POST
请求头:
  • Content-Type:application/json
参数:
参数名必填数据类型说明
appidstring设备id
namestring标签名

返回数据:
参数名数据类型说明
retnumber0:成功
msgstring反馈信息
dataobject
labelCountnumber标签个数
labelPairListobject标签列表
labelNameobject标签名称
labelIDobject标签id

请求参数示例:
   {
       "appid": "wx_nScLwnZhfNmlQlL0npc71",
       "name": "加人",
   }

成功返回示例:
   {
        "ret": 0,
        "msg": "success",
        "data": {
            "BaseResponse": {
                "ret": 0,
                "errMsg": {}
            },
            "LabelCount": 1,
            "LabelPairList": {
                "labelName": "加人",
                "labelID": 17
            }
        }
    }

错误返回示例:
    {
        "ret": 0,
        "msg": "success",
        "data": {
            "BaseResponse": {
                "ret": -2,
                "errMsg": {
                    "string": "args error"
                }
            },
            "LabelCount": 0
        }
    }

删除标签

简要描述:
  • 删除已添加的标签
  • 注意[id]
请求URL:
  • http://域名地址/api/label/delete
请求方式:
  • POST
请求头:
  • Content-Type:application/json
参数:
参数名称数据类型必填说明
appidstring设备id
idstring标签id

返回数据:
参数名数据类型说明
retnumber0:成功
msgstring反馈信息
dataobject

请求参数示例:
   {
       "appid": "wx_nScLwnZhfNmlQlL0npc71",
       "id": 17,
   }

成功返回示例:
   {
        "ret": 0,
        "msg": "success",
        "data": {
            "BaseResponse": {
                "ret": 0,
                "errMsg": {}
            }
        }
    }

错误返回示例:
    {
        "ret": -1,
        "msg_err": "[wx_bpPSNW0kK0xYSM6ldubd]设备不存在或已离线"
    }

标签列表

简要描述:
  • 获取所有标签
请求URL:
  • http://域名地址/api/label/list
请求方式:
  • POST
请求头:
  • Content-Type:application/json

  • X-GEWE-TOKEN: 后台获取

参数:
参数名必填数据类型说明
appidstring设备id

返回数据:
参数名数据类型说明
retnumber0:成功
msgstring反馈信息
dataobject
labelCountnumber标签个数
labelPairListobject标签列表
labelNamestring标签名
labelIDstring标签id

请求参数示例:
   {
       "appid": "wx_nScLwnZhfNmlQlL0npc71",
       "sync_key": "",
   }

成功返回示例:
   {
        "ret": 0,
        "msg": "success",
        "data": {
            "BaseResponse": {
                "ret": 0,
                "errMsg": {}
            },
            "labelCount": 5,
            "labelPairList": [
                {
                    "labelName": "前端",
                    "labelID": 2
                },
                {
                    "labelName": "朋友",
                    "labelID": 5
                },
                {
                    "labelName": "技术",
                    "labelID": 14
                },
                {
                    "labelName": "同学",
                    "labelID": 15
                },
                {
                    "labelName": "123",
                    "labelID": 16
                }
            ]
        }
    }

错误返回示例:
    {
        "ret": -1,
        "msg_err": "[wx_bpPSNW0kK0xYSM6ldubd]设备不存在或已离线"
    }

修改标签

简要描述:
  • 修改标签下的联系人
  • 注意结构
请求URL:
  • http://域名地址/api/label/modifylist
请求方式:
  • POST
请求头:
  • Content-Type:application/json
参数:
参数名称数据类型必填说明
appidstring设备id
idstring标签id
to_wxid_listarray联系人wxid

返回数据:
参数名数据类型说明
retnumber0:成功
msgstring反馈信息
dataobject

请求参数示例:
   {
       "appid": "wx_nScLwnZhfNmlQlL0npc71",
       "id": 16,
       "to_wxid_list": [
           "wxid_4bxxxxxxxxxxx22"
       ],
   }

成功返回示例:
   {
        "ret": 0,
        "msg": "success",
        "data": {
            "BaseResponse": {
                "ret": 0,
                "errMsg": {}
            }
        }
    }

错误返回示例:
    {
        "ret": 0,
        "msg": "success",
        "data": {
            "BaseResponse": {
                "ret": -2,
                "errMsg": {
                    "string": "args error"
                }
            }
        }
    }

修改标签名

简要描述:
  • 更改标签名称
  • 注意参数
请求URL:
  • http://域名地址/api/label/modifyname
请求方式:
  • POST
请求头:
  • Content-Type:application/json
参数:
参数名称数据类型必填说明
appidstring设备id
idnumber标签id
namestring标签名

返回数据:
参数名数据类型说明
retnumber0:成功
msgstring反馈信息
dataobject

请求参数示例:
   {
       "appid": "wx_nScLwnZhfNmlQlL0npc71",
       "id": 16,
       "name": "加人",
   }

成功返回示例:
   {
        "ret": 0,
        "msg": "success",
        "data": {
            "BaseResponse": {
                "ret": 0,
                "errMsg": {}
            }
        }
    }

错误返回示例:
    {
        "ret": 0,
        "msg": "success",
        "data": {
            "BaseResponse": {
                "ret": -2,
                "errMsg": {
                    "string": "args error"
                }
            }
        }
    }

  • 1
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

iPad协议个微协议

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值